Consideration
Yesterday’s parables continue in the stoning scene. ‘Lord Jesus, receive my spirit’ and, in a loud voice, ‘Lord, do not charge them with this sin’ are the laments. Notable in this account is the mention of Paul, then the persecutor of Christians. Luke writes: ‘Paul consented to the murder of this man, and Paul too will later confirm this: ‘I persecuted God’s Church’. Luke clearly has an intention when he accentuates Paul’s presence as a persecutor. The phrase about Paul follows immediately after quoting Stephen’s words – ‘Lord do not charge them with this sin.’ Did Paul hear these words of forgiveness – and did he already understand at that point that he had to make a radical break with his life ?
